Transaction 1ecaff7d500dcb010c34c6b370255bd291900957a80c74cc9124333b90f7e15a
1 Input
1 Output
-
1ecaff7d500dcb010c34c6b370255bd291900957a80c74cc9124333b90f7e15a:0
- value
- 480000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ad165f9ea25fc048b0c5f0bff70dfc662031d0c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pbrSxQ7DFBYAuzGVH1nFNPCpzVZJ6cSr